Indulge in Luxury: How to Take a Spa-Worthy Bath at Home

In the hustle of everyday life, taking time for yourself isn’t just a luxury—it’s a necessity. One of the simplest yet most effective ways to recharge both mind and body is by indulging in a luxurious bath at home. You don’t need a five-star spa to experience deep relaxation—you can create a sanctuary right in your own bathroom. Here’s how to turn your next soak into a full-blown self-care ritual:

1. Set the Mood with Ambience

Luxury begins with the atmosphere. Dim the lights and bring in some candles (think calming scents like lavender, sandalwood, or eucalyptus). If candles aren’t your thing, a soft lamp or dimmable bathroom light works too. Don’t forget your favorite playlist—whether it’s soothing spa sounds, R&B, or your go-to chill mix.


2. Upgrade Your Bath Products

Trade in your basic bubbles for high-quality, skin-loving bath additives. Look for:

  • Bath salts with magnesium for muscle relaxation

  • Essential oil blends for aromatherapy benefits

  • Foaming bath soaks or milk baths for a silky, moisturizing touch

  • Herbal bath teas with chamomile, calendula, or rose petals

3. Add a Touch of Nature

Elevate your bath by incorporating natural elements. Fresh eucalyptus sprigs hung on the shower head can release a calming scent from the steam. You can also sprinkle dried rose petals or citrus slices into the water for a visual and aromatic boost.


4. Pamper Yourself Like You’re at the Spa

While you soak, treat yourself to spa-like extras:

  • Apply a face mask or under-eye patches

  • Use a silk or cold eye pillow for added relaxation

  • Keep infused water or herbal tea nearby to stay hydrated

  • Grab a good book or listen to a guided meditation

5. Wrap Up in Comfort

After your bath, keep the pampering going. Wrap up in a plush robe or heated towel. Massage in a rich body oil or cream while your skin is still damp to lock in moisture. Consider a calming skincare routine to end the experience on a high note.


6. Make it a Ritual

Set a regular “luxury bath night”—whether it’s Sunday evenings or mid-week resets. The more consistent your self-care rituals, the more your mind and body begin to recognize and respond to them.
